Transportation Code § 623.193","heading":"DESIGNATED ROUTE IN MUNICIPALITY.","body":"(a) A municipality having a state highway in its territory may designate to the department the route in the municipality to be used by a vehicle described by Section 623.192 operating over the state highway. The department shall show the designated route on each map routing the vehicle.\n(b) If a municipality does not designate a route, the department shall determine the route of the vehicle on each state highway in the municipality.\n(c) A municipality may not require a fee, permit, or license for movement of the vehicles on the route of a state highway designated by the municipality or department.\nActs 1995, 74th Leg., ch. 165, Sec. 1, eff.
